アプリケーションの説明

ストリート・コンバット、鮮やかなピクセルアート、ノスタルジックなチップチューンミュージックが特徴の、アドレナリン満載のパルクール・エンドレスランナーを体験してください。

ネオン輝く都市の広がりをダッシュで駆け抜け、動的な障害物を回避し、ライバルと戦い、グローバルリーダーボードを駆け上がれ。無限に自動生成される地形が待ち受ける。右にスワイプで跳躍、左をタップでスタイリッシュなアクロバティックを決めよう。
